Gengjie Chen is a scholar working on Electrical and Electronic Engineering, Hardware and Architecture and Computer Networks and Communications. According to data from OpenAlex, Gengjie Chen has authored 26 papers receiving a total of 386 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Electrical and Electronic Engineering, 15 papers in Hardware and Architecture and 4 papers in Computer Networks and Communications. Recurrent topics in Gengjie Chen's work include VLSI and FPGA Design Techniques (19 papers), VLSI and Analog Circuit Testing (13 papers) and Low-power high-performance VLSI design (10 papers). Gengjie Chen is often cited by papers focused on VLSI and FPGA Design Techniques (19 papers), VLSI and Analog Circuit Testing (13 papers) and Low-power high-performance VLSI design (10 papers). Gengjie Chen collaborates with scholars based in Hong Kong, China and India. Gengjie Chen's co-authors include Evangeline F. Y. Young, Bei Yu, Chak-Wa Pui, Haocheng Li, Wing-Kai Chow, Jingsong Chen, Jian Kuang, Yuzhe Ma, Jinwei Liu and Hang Zhang and has published in prestigious journals such as IEEE Transactions on Computer-Aided Design of Integrated Circuits and Systems, Rare & Special e-Zone (The Hong Kong University of Science and Technology) and International Conference on Computer Aided Design.
